Short Term Disability - Aflac
You are eligible to purchase Short Term Disability through AFLAC. If you are working while coverage in force and a covered off-the-job injury causes you to become totally disabled, AFLAC will pay the following benefits:

You can purchase a weekly benefit up to a maximum of $2,000 without providing evidence of insurability. Disability must begin within 90 days of your last treatment for the covered off-the-job injury. A full-time job is your primary job at which you work 19 or more hours per week for pay or benefits. Total disability is defined as being unable to perform the substantial and material duties of the employee's occupation; and be receiving care by a physician which is appropriate for the condition causing the disability; and not be gainfully employed or occupied in any other occupation.
